Heidi Lau and Wong Ping Awarded 2025 Sigg Prize by M+

The contemporary art museum M+ in Hong Kong has recognized Heidi Lau and Wong Ping as the winners of the 2025 Sigg Prize. This prestigious award is given every two years to honor artists who have made a notable impact on contemporary art within the Greater China region.

Heidi Lau has gained acclaim for her detailed ceramic artworks, which delve into themes surrounding mythology and history. In contrast, Wong Ping uses animation and various multimedia forms to address social and political themes, offering a unique perspective on these issues.

As recipients of the Sigg Prize, Lau and Ping will not only receive a financial award but also have the opportunity to showcase their creations in an exhibition at M+. This platform will offer them significant exposure and recognition in the art world.
